Today's episode is about the greatest meth binge in history, and what led to the circumstances that allowed it to happen. We hope you like it! Also, we promise the audio and editing quality will get better, we're just new to it. :)
Please join us on a fun and sometimes horrifying historical journey! New episodes drop every other Monday.
